Generic pantoprazole typically appears as a light pink to reddish-brown, oval-shaped tablet, often imprinted with identifying numbers or letters. It is usually available in various strengths, such as 20 mg and 40 mg. The tablets are designed to be taken orally and may have a smooth coating. Always refer to a pharmacist or healthcare provider for specific visual identification.
